As you might guess, the movie has been roundly criticized as, well, WRONG: As just one article from the Atlanta Journal-Constitution:
While it’s possible that some of the alleged perpetrators shown in the movie actually committed a crime, video surveillance of drop boxes alone doesn’t prove anything. Voters might have been delivering ballots for their relatives, which is allowed.
Even if there were a ballot harvesting scheme, it wouldn’t invalidate legitimate ballots just because they were turned in by unauthorized individuals. Verified ballots of registered voters still count, regardless of how they were delivered.

Election investigators have reviewed several videos included in “2000 Mules” and found no illegal behavior, including a video that showed a Gwinnett County man inserting ballots into a drop box, according to the secretary of state’s office.
